Duke Capo Sells Cocktails with Cute 3D Toppings

A bar in Tokyo, Japan called Duke Capo is known for its delectable drinks and the cocktail art that accompanies them. The bartenders and mixologists use cream, chocolate sauce and booze to make cute 3D designs that pop up from the drinking glasses.

The creamy works of art float on top of each drink. They are so perfectly placed you probably won't want to take a sip and ruin them. Some of the designs that have been showcased so far include a white teddy bear with a pink bow that is holding a rose, a frog that is surrounded with lilly pads and appears to be emerging from the drink and a pair of penguins.

The art form is creative way for people to make classic drinks more fun and modern.
